James Martin and Anita Rani join This Morning

James Martin and Anita Rani are set to host ‘This Morning’ every Friday throughout the summer.
The pair will begin their presenting duties this week (22.07.16) in replace of Eamonn Holmes and Ruth Langsford, who are standing in for Holly Willoughby and Phillip Schofield Monday to Friday, and can’t wait to get stuck in to their new role on the award-winning show.
James, 44, said: "It’s such a privilege to be asked back to do it again, I have a great time there."
Anita, 38, added: "I’m so excited to be joining the fantastic team at ‘This Morning’. What a brilliant way to spend Fridays over the summer."
Although James has presented the show before on numerous occasions and he used to host his own BBC programme ‘Saturday Kitchen’, he has admitted he’s still riddled with nerves when he stands in front of the camera.
He said: "It can be nerve wracking at times because you’re always a little unsure about what could happen next! I can handle the food items and talk about that no problem, but to go from such light and shade topics… it’s one of the toughest gigs in television without a shadow of a doubt and you realise what pros they are that do this job. But I’ll do my best, as that’s all I’ve done for the last 20 years!"
And Anita can’t wait to pick James’ brains for culinary tips.
She said: "Many hours of my life – certainly when I was a student – have been spent watching this daytime TV institution, so I genuinely cannot wait to see what’s in store over the coming weeks. And I’ll use the opportunity to pick James Martin’s brilliant cooking brain for top tips and get misty-eyed over Yorkshire with him. Roll on Friday!"
